Sadus
is an American highly technical thrash metal trio from Antioch, California.

History
Sadus was formed in 1984 in Antioch, California. While its very first efforts were based highly on
Slayer, the band gradually progressed and developed its sound into a unique, innovative kind of music. Despite suffering from poor media exposure, the band has been able to reach some of the highest peaks in the
technical metal genre, due to the improving musicianship of its members.
The band name was suggested by a friend of the band named Rick Rogers in 1985. It was originally taken from the novel
Dune
where Sadus are judges. The Fremen title refers to holy judges, equivalent to saints.

However, according to bass guitarist/vocalist
Steve DiGiorgio: "He (Rogers) liked the sound of it and he said he could make it into a cool logo. So we chose it [...] it's not supposed to have a meaning as we don't stand for anything."
